How PX to EM Conversion Works
In CSS, px (pixels) are absolute units while em and rem are relative units. 1 em equals the font size of the parent element, and 1 rem equals the root font size (typically 16px). To convert px to em: divide by the parent font size. To convert px to rem: divide by 16. Using relative units like em and rem helps create responsive designs that scale properly across devices.
